A cyborg is a cybernetic organism, a being with both organic and visible biomechatronic body parts. Cybernetics is the study of complex artificial intelligence systems often housed inside robotic machines, androids or cyborgs. Mechanical replacements for body parts are called cybernetic implants. Like all cybernetic lifeforms, cyborgs cannot survive without their biological components.

Cyborgs are of biological origin with robotic or mechanical parts meant to extend their capabilities, as opposed to androids which are robotic AI that are made to look and act human. Bionics is the application of biological methods and systems in the engineering of technology, whereas cybernetic implants are used to enhance cyborgs. An example of bionics is an artificial neural network, as this is how a human brain works.

Cybernetic eyes (for example) with artificial retinas will match the visual quality of a real human eye. They will contain electrode arrays with hundreds of megapixels in full color along with wireless capabilities. They will not only provide a cure to blindness for many people, but they also contain further enhancements like embedded cameras, WiFi, augmented reality, night vision, thermal vision, zoom capability, and so on.
